Gonzalo Boye, a lawyer, businessman, and editor of Mongolia magazine, was convicted in the 1990s for allegedly collaborating with ETA in a kidnapping, a crime he denies. His story, told in a documentary by Sebastián Arabia, begins in Chile and continues in Spain, where he served 14 years in prison. During this time, he studied law and later handled significant cases like the 11M trials, the Bárcenas case, defending Edward Snowden, and suing the George W. Bush administration over Guantanamo.
